Subject: Potential acquisition of Tellswick Analytics

Tellswick Analytics, a forty-person firm based in Corvane, has been approached regarding a full acquisition. Preliminary valuation lands between 18 and 22 million, supported by recurring revenue and low churn. Their platform would close the reporting gap in our Meridel product line. Key risks are founder retention and an expiring data-hosting contract. Diligence would take roughly eight weeks. The rationale tying this to our broader direction is captured in the note below.

management briefing: Ralokix Partners plans to lower the Istath list price by 38 percent in October.

14:22 — So this is where things got interesting. We flipped on zstd compression for Pulsewire telemetry payloads, and the collector in the Ostmark region started rejecting about a third of them. Turns out the decompressor cap was set way too low for batched events. Marta bumped the limit and replayed the backlog. The offending release is identified by the token below.

pipeline stamp: htk31_f769b577b3028a4e9958e5bb8d1259a

## GC Pauses — PairWell Matching Service

If match latency alerts fire and logs show long stop-the-world pauses, first confirm it's GC and not lock contention: check the pause-time panel on the matching dashboard. Pauses over 2s usually mean the candidate cache has bloated; restarting the affected node drains it safely since matches are replayed from the queue. To pull detailed heap stats, query the internal diagnostics service directly — it requires authentication. Use the on-call key shown below.

gateway credential: kto3_qfe